A BILL to amend and reenact section thirteen, article two,
chapter eighteen-a of the code of West Virginia, one
thousand nine hundred thirty-one, as amended, relating to
mandating that county boards of education follow the
recommended guidelines for scheduling cooks.
Be it enacted by the Legislature of West Virginia:
That section thirteen, article two, chapter eighteen-a of
the code of West Virginia, one thousand nine hundred thirty-one,
as amended, be amended and reenacted to read as follows:
ARTICLE 2. SCHOOL PERSONNEL.
§18A-2-13. Mandatory guidelines for full-day and half-day


cooks.
The following guidelines are optional mandatory guidelines
that county boards may shall use when scheduling full-day and
half-day cooks:

A meal prepared for a school lunch shall be established as
a whole meal. Other meals shall be equal to three fourths of a school lunch meal.



NOTE: The purpose of this bill is to require boards to
follow the statutory guidelines as to the ratio of cooks to the
number of meals to be served.
